    How Does an Auto On/off Switch Fail on a Pressure Washer? the Short Answer and the Bigger Picture

    Mark JensenBy Mark JensenAugust 1, 2026No Comments4 Mins Read

    An auto on/off switch failure on a pressure washer usually results from electrical issues or mechanical wear. Common symptoms include the machine not starting or shutting off unexpectedly, often requiring inspection and replacement of the switch or related components.

    Step-by-Step Fix for Auto On/Off Switch

    When an auto on/off switch malfunctions in a pressure washer, it can disrupt the entire cleaning process. Understanding the specific steps to troubleshoot and repair this component is essential for restoring functionality. This guide provides a clear, systematic approach to effectively address the issue and get your pressure washer back in working order.

    Follow these steps to diagnose and fix an auto on/off switch failure in a pressure washer:

    1. Disconnect power supply to ensure safety.

    2. Inspect the switch for visible damage or corrosion.

    3. Test the switch using a multimeter to check continuity.

    4. Examine wiring for frayed or loose connections.

    5. Replace the switch if it is faulty or damaged.

    6. Reassemble the pressure washer and reconnect the power supply.

    7. Test the machine to ensure proper functionality.

    This methodical approach can help restore the pressure washer’s operation effectively.
